Insight.
Resilient organizations absorb shocks and emerge stronger. CEOs must anticipate disruption and build adaptive capacity across the business.
Key Strategies:
1. Stress-Test Plans – Prepare for downside scenarios.
2. Diversify Revenue and Supply – Reduce dependency risks.
3. Build Decision Agility – Enable fast responses.
4. Invest in Leadership Capability – Resilience starts at the top.
5. Communicate Calmly During Uncertainty – Confidence stabilizes teams.
CEO Leadership Actions.
✅ Lead resilience planning sessions.
✅ Review contingency plans.
✅ Reinforce adaptability as a leadership value.
Actionable Tip.
- Identify one vulnerability—develop a contingency plan this month.
Why This Matters?
Resilience protects continuity, reputation, and value.
